Fakeflix

仿 Netflix 的练手 Web 项目
授权协议 MIT
开发语言 JavaScript
所属分类 Web应用开发、 响应式 Web 框架
软件类型 开源软件
地区 不详
投 递 者 法子昂
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

Fakeflix 是一个模仿 Netflix 的项目,原作者通过它来学习使用 Redux 构建一个中等复杂度的 Web 应用。

Fakeflix 复制了 Netflix 的原有布局,并在此基础之上添加了自己的路由和交互动效。所以 Fakeflix 不是常见的克隆项目。

主要特性

  •  无限滚动的类别相关页面
  • 支持按标题、演员、电影导演搜索资源
  • “我的列表”具有添加/删除功能
  • 响应式布局
  • 支持登录和注册
  • 使用了 React hooks 和自定义的 hooks
  • 提供加载骨架屏 (Loading skeletons)

 相关资料
  • Python 的练手项目有哪些值得推荐?

  • 本文向大家介绍js仿腾讯QQ的web登陆界面,包括了js仿腾讯QQ的web登陆界面的使用技巧和注意事项,需要的朋友参考一下 用了腾讯QQ也有将近十年了,今天心血来潮想模仿腾讯QQ的登陆面板做一个web版的登陆面板,然后参考了一些代码,自己模仿,学写了一个。  效果如下:  其中还实现了拖动面板,选择状态的效果 下面是具体代码: 1.index.html   2.css/main.css:   3.

  • introduction zuul用来提供动态路由、监控、授权、安全、调度等等的边缘服务(edge service) ZuulFilter ZuulFilter是Zuul中核心组件,通过继承该抽象类,覆写几个关键方法达到自定义调度请求的作用,这里filter不是java web中的filter,不要混淆. new ZuulFilter() { @Override

  • Conductor 是 Netflix 受需要运行全球流媒体业务流程的启发,构建的基于云的微服务编排引擎。 Conductor 管理工作流,可以暂停和重新启动进程,并使用基于 JSON DSL 的蓝图来定义执行流。 它还具有可视化流程流的用户界面,并可扩展到数百万个并发运行的流程流。

  • Genie 是 Netflix 联合作业执行引擎,提供 REST-ful APIs,运行各种类型的大数据作业,比如 Hadoop,Pig,Hive,Spark,Presto,Sqoop 等等。Genie 同时提供 APis 来管理在上面运行的大量的分布式进程集群配置,命令和应用。

  • Netflix Servo 用 Java 语言,提供暴露、发布应用运行指标的简单接口,主要满足的需求包括:使用JMX、简单、灵活发布。 示例代码: public class Server { @MonitorId private final String id; @Monitor(name="Status", type=INFORMATIONAL) private Atom